Merge \\"Disable instead of hiding add account preference\\" into nyc-mr1-dev am: 8738e406c8
am: c76f7fcba1
Change-Id: I5ad4443041ef51f420fa056b8dbcd9af9d8fc5a5
This commit is contained in:
@@ -310,9 +310,11 @@ public class AccountSettings extends SettingsPreferenceFragment
|
||||
if (userInfo.isEnabled()) {
|
||||
profileData.authenticatorHelper = new AuthenticatorHelper(context,
|
||||
userInfo.getUserHandle(), this);
|
||||
if (!RestrictedLockUtils.hasBaseUserRestriction(context,
|
||||
profileData.addAccountPreference = newAddAccountPreference(context);
|
||||
if (RestrictedLockUtils.hasBaseUserRestriction(context,
|
||||
UserManager.DISALLOW_MODIFY_ACCOUNTS, userInfo.id)) {
|
||||
profileData.addAccountPreference = newAddAccountPreference(context);
|
||||
profileData.addAccountPreference.setEnabled(false);
|
||||
} else {
|
||||
profileData.addAccountPreference.checkRestrictionAndSetDisabled(
|
||||
DISALLOW_MODIFY_ACCOUNTS, userInfo.id);
|
||||
}
|
||||
|
Reference in New Issue
Block a user